IGP Adamu Announces Disbandment Of SARS

The Special Anti-Robbery Squad (SARS) has been disbanded.

The Inspector General of Police, Mohammed Adamu announced the disbandment in a live broadcast on Sunday, October 11, 2020.

The announcement by the police boss came after days of nationwide protests against SARS operatives’ brutality and extra-judicial killings.
